Changeset 4633


Ignore:
Timestamp:
03/06/14 15:20:14 (10 years ago)
Author:
Twan Goosen
Message:

added extra fields to be retrieved for a document

File:
1 edited

Legend:

Unmodified
Added
Removed
  • vlo/branches/vlo-3.0/vlo-web-app/src/main/java/eu/clarin/cmdi/vlo/service/impl/SolrDocumentQueryFactoryImpl.java

    r4629 r4633  
    2727 */
    2828public class SolrDocumentQueryFactoryImpl extends AbstractSolrQueryFactory implements SolrDocumentQueryFactory {
    29    
     29
    3030    @Override
    3131    public SolrQuery createDocumentQuery(QueryFacetsSelection selection, int first, int count) {
     
    3939        return query;
    4040    }
    41    
     41
    4242    @Override
    4343    public SolrQuery createDocumentQuery(String docId) {
     
    5151        query.setRows(1);
    5252        return query;
    53        
     53
    5454    }
    55    
     55
    5656    private SolrQuery getDefaultDocumentQuery() {
    5757        SolrQuery query = new SolrQuery();
    58         query.setFields(FacetConstants.FIELD_NAME,
    59                 FacetConstants.FIELD_ID,
    60                 FacetConstants.FIELD_DESCRIPTION,
     58        query.setFields(FacetConstants.FIELD_NAME,
     59                FacetConstants.FIELD_DESCRIPTION,
    6160                FacetConstants.FIELD_COLLECTION,
     61                FacetConstants.FIELD_GENRE,
     62                FacetConstants.FIELD_LANGUAGE,
     63                FacetConstants.FIELD_NATIONAL_PROJECT,
     64                FacetConstants.FIELD_RESOURCE_CLASS,
    6265                FacetConstants.FIELD_RESOURCE,
    63                 FacetConstants.FIELD_LANDINGPAGE);
     66                FacetConstants.FIELD_LANDINGPAGE,
     67                FacetConstants.FIELD_ID
     68        );
    6469        query.setSort(SolrQuery.SortClause.asc(FacetConstants.FIELD_NAME));
    6570        return query;
Note: See TracChangeset for help on using the changeset viewer.